Five killed in Narayanganj road crashes

Dhaka – Five people were killed and 30 others injured in road accidents in Sonargaon and Fatullah of the city on Friday.
Three people were killed and 10 others injured in a head-on collision between a truck and a battery-run easy-bike at Masdair under Fatullah Police Station of the city at night.The deceased could not be identified immediately.
Officer-in-charge of Fatullah Police Station Abdul Malek said the accident took place around 12am when the truck collided with the auto-rickshaw around 12am, leaving three auto-rickshaw passengers dead on the spot and its 10 others injured. The injured were taken to Sadar Hospital.
Meanwhile, two people were killed and 20 others injured as a bus carrying a bridal party plunged into a roadside ditch at Nayapur in Sonargaon upazila, about 20 kilometres east of Dhaka on Friday, unb news agency reported.
The deceased could not be identified immediately.
Police and witnesses said the Rupganj-bound bus from Gazaria of Munshiganj carrying a group of 25-30 bridal party fell into the ditch after it collided with a pickup van on Madanpur-Joydebpur road in the area around 10pm, leaving two passengers dead on the spot and 20 others injured.
The injured were taken to different hospitals, including Dhaka Medical College Hospital in the capital.
